Where does “שום” come from?
שום (Hebrew) comes from Aramaic שום, from Aramaic שְׁמָא, from Proto-Semitic šim-, from Proto-Afroasiatic sim- — name.

Ancestry of “שום”, step by step
| Step | Language | Word | Meaning |
|---|
| 1 | Aramaic | שום | singular construct state of שְׁמָא |
| 2 | Aramaic | שְׁמָא | name |
| 3 | Proto-Semitic | šim- | name |
| 4 | Proto-Afroasiatic | sim- | name |
